About: With over 15 years of active pet-sitting experience and a lifetime of caring for animals, I bring compassion, playful attentiveness, and calm confidence to every home I visit. In 2024, I spent four months road-tripping across the U.S., housesitting along the way and caring for 7 cats and 14 dogs in 10 households—ranging widely in breed, age, temperament, and needs. This experience left me especially comfortable quickly building trusting relationships with new animals and adapting to their individual personalities. I have extensive experience with medically complex pets, including administering pills and liquid medications, giving injections, and providing wound care. I understand the importance of consistent routines, detailed observation, and gentle handling when working with animals who require special attention. Whether caring for playful puppies, senior cats, or anything in between, I offer dependable, compassionate care tailored to each pet's unique needs. I work four days a week, Thurs-Sun in the afternoon and evening. On work days, I am available in the morning and late-evening. Mon-Wed I have full availability for all types of care. I prioritize safety and active stimulation for my own pets and those I care for. In addition to maintaining feeding schedules and security, I make sure those animals in my care receive exercise and mental stimulation, depending on their needs.

House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Striebels Corner on Rover as of Aug 2025 was about $60 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.
As of Aug 2025, there are 5,521 house sitters in Striebels Corner.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 86% of Striebels Corner house sitters respond in under an hour.
House sitters in Striebels Corner have an average of 14 years of experience. House sitters with repeat customers have an average of 5 repeat clients.
